RESOLUTION NO. 303 12
A RESOLUTION URGING THE 2013 HAWAII STATE LEGISLATURE TO REPEAL
CHAPTER 171C OF THE HAWAII REVISED STATUTES TO EFFECTIVELY
ABOLISH THE PUBLIC LAND DEVELOPMENT CORPORATION.
WHEREAS, on May 3, 2011, the Hawai`i State Legislature approved SB1555 SD2 HD2
CD1, to create the Public Land Development Corporation ("corporation"), which was signed into
law(Act 055) by the Honorable Governor Neil Abercrombie on May 20, 2011, which was then
codified as Chapter 171C of the Hawai`i Revised Statutes ("HRS 171C"); and
WHEREAS, HRS 171C-4, subsection (a), in part, defines the powers of the Public Land
Development Corporation as (underscoring for emphasis only):
"(a) Except as otherwise limited by this chapter, the corporation may:
(7) Acquire or contract to acquire by grant or purchase:
(A) All privately owned real property or any interest therein and the improvements
thereon, if any, that are determined by the corporation to be necessary or
appropriate for its purposes under this chapter, including real property together
with improvements, if any, in excess of that needed for such use in cases where
small remnants would otherwise be left or where other justifiable cause
necessitates the acquisition to protect and preserve the contemplated
improvements, or public policy demands the acquisition in connection with such
improvements; and
(10) In cooperation with any governmental agency, or otherwise through direct investment or
coventure with a professional investor or enterprise or any other person, or otherwise,
acquire, construct, operate, and maintain public land facilities, including but not limited
to leisure, recreational, commercial, residential, time share, hotel, office space, and
business facilities, at rates or charges determined by the corporation;
(11) Assist developmental, recreational, and visitor-industry related enterprises, or projects
developed or managed by the corporation, by conducting detailed marketing analysis and
developing marketing and promotional strategies to strengthen the position of those
enterprises and to better exploit local, national, and international markets;
(18) Issue bonds to finance the cost of a project and to provide for the security thereof, in the
manner and pursuant to the procedure prescribed in this chapter;
(19) Subject to approval by the department, assume management responsibilities for small
boat harbors in accordance with chapter 200 and any rules adopted pursuant thereto for
periods not to exceed one year;
(20) Recommend to the board of land and natural resources the purchase of any privately
owned properties that may be appropriate for development"; and
WHEREAS, HRS 171C-4, subsection (c)reads:
"(c) The powers conferred herein shall be liberally construed to effectuate the
purposes of this chapter"; and
WHEREAS, the County of Hawai`i currently has severe problems with traffic
circulation issues, insufficient numbers of police officers and fire fighters, insufficient potable
water wells in many areas, insufficient sewer capabilities in many areas. Allowing uncontrolled
development in violation of our zoning, building, road design, and flooding codes, and ignoring
the lack of sufficient potable water availability, and traffic circulation issues would exacerbate
these problems for the entire community and cost the taxpayers great expense in the future to
rectify the exacerbated problems; and
WHEREAS, the County of Hawai`i has enacted or is in the process of enacting
Community Development Plans, which may be ignored due to HRS 171C; and
WHEREAS, only revenue generating uses are specifically mentioned in HRS 171C, so
the "optimal use" appears to be those businesses that can generate the highest amount of revenue
(hotels, resorts, commercial centers, agri-business for genetically modified crops, etc.), with no
regard for parks or other types of community resources; and
WHEREAS, development of residential units will not provide "fair share" contributions
because there is no code for"fair share"; and
WHEREAS, our scarce supply of potable water could be diverted to these potential
developments; and
WHEREAS, affordable housing in the 60-100% median range will not be developed;
and
WHEREAS,truly affordable housing may be built on the opposite side of this island
from where the job centers or the developments are located; and
WHEREAS, there is concern that large agri-businesses using GM crops may be
instituted on public trust lands the Island of Hawai`i in disregard of Hawai`i County Code,
Chapter 14 Article 15, which prohibits the agricultural use of genetically engineered coffee and
kalo; and
WHEREAS, HRS 171C allows ceded lands to be used not for homes for our Hawaiian
families, but for the revenue production for the State; and
WHEREAS,the people of the County of Hawai`i now realize the detrimental effect that
HRS 171C will have on our land, ocean, environment, and the avoidance of many of our zoning
and subdivision laws, which HRS 171C may ignore; and
WHEREAS,the people of the County of Hawai`i have requested assistance from the
Council of the County of Hawai`i to support the repeal of HRS 171C; now, therefore,
BE IT RESOLVED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E COUNTY OF HAWAII that the
2013 Hawai`i State Legislature is hereby requested to repeal Chapter 171C of the Hawai`i
Revised Statutes in its entirety to effectively abolish the Public Land Development Corporation.
